Validating the Gaming Disorder Identification Test in English, Chinese, Dutch and Indonesian
Gary Chung Kai Chan1, Daniel Stjepanović1, John B Saunders1
1National Centre for Youth Substance Use Research, Faculty of Health Medicine and Behavioural Sciences, The University of Queensland, Brisbane, Australia.
Background And Aims:
Gaming disorder has been formally recognised in the International Classification of Diseases, 11th Revision (ICD-11), but purpose-designed and internationally validated screening tools remain limited. We aimed to assess the psychometric properties of the Gaming Disorder Identification Test (GADIT) to screen for past 12 months gaming disorder across multiple languages and countries.
Design:
Cross-sectional multi-country online survey.
Setting And Participants:
1522 adults aged ≥18 who played video games at least 3 hours per week (303 from Australia; 314 from China; 300 from Indonesia; 303 from the Netherlands; and 302 from the USA).
Measurements:
The (English) GADIT is an eight-item self-report questionnaire based on a selection from 25 items measuring the four ICD-11 essential features of gaming disorder. The 25 items were translated into Chinese, Dutch and Indonesian. We conducted: (1) four item response theory (IRT) analyses and reliability assessments for the items of each of the four ICD-11 criteria for gaming disorder based using the 25 items (inclusive of the eight GADIT items); (2) a multi-group confirmatory factor analysis across countries using the 8 GADIT items (2 from each ICD criterion, same selection across all countries); (3) six separate IRT analyses for each of the five countries and one analysis for all countries combined using the 8 GADIT items; and (4) validity tests of the association between GADIT and measures with an expected correlation with it, including the Internet Gaming Disorder Test (IGDT-10 total score), depression score (Patient Health Questionnaire-2), anxiety score (GAD-2), gaming intensity (high/low) and gaming-related financial problems (yes/no).
Results:
Items measuring the four gaming disorder criteria had good internal consistency (α ≥ 0.85). Multi-group confirmatory factor analysis of the 8 items indicated factor loading invariance across countries [χ2(28) = 19.36, P = 0.886; root mean square error of approximation = 0.054; comparative fit index = 0.986; Tucker-Lewis Index = 0.984]. There was lower sensitivity for the physical complaint items in China and Indonesia compared with Australia, Netherlands and USA. Overall, the 8-item GADIT had strong concurrent validity with the IGDT-10 [regression coefficient (b) = 0.67, coefficient of determination (R2) = 52%] and was statistically significantly associated with depression (b = 0.38, R2 = 21%), anxiety (b = 0.35, R2 = 20%), gaming intensity [odds ratio (OR) = 3.11, 95% confidence interval (CI) = 2.72-3.60] and gaming-related financial problems (OR = 3.11, 95% CI = 2.70-3.59).
Summary:
The 8-item Gaming Disorder Identification Test screening tool in Chinese, Dutch and Indonesian translation generally demonstrates robust psychometric properties and high validity, but cultural and/or language minor modifications may further improve international use.
